Factors Influencing Car Locksmith Prices
Before diving into rates specifics, it's vital to understand the numerous aspects that can impact car locksmith costs. Here's a breakdown:
FactorDescriptionKind of ServiceDifferent services (lockout support, crucial duplication, ignition repair, and so on) have differing expenses.Vehicle Make and ModelLuxury or specialized automobiles may require more complicated locksmith methods, leading to greater costs.Time of ServiceAfter-hours or emergency situation services normally incur higher charges.AreaGeographical place plays a significant role; city locations frequently have greater rates than rural locales.Experience of the LocksmithMore knowledgeable locksmith professionals or those with specialized training may charge greater costs for their proficiency.Typical Car Locksmith Prices
The following table offers a basic overview of car locksmith rates based on the type of service rendered. Bear in mind that these are average price quotes and can vary:
Service TypeTypical Cost RangeLockout Assistance₤ 50 - ₤ 150Secret Duplication₤ 10 - ₤ 200 (depending on essential type)Ignition Repair/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 250Transponder Key Programming₤ 50 - ₤ 300Secret Extraction₤ 60 - ₤ 200Emergency Services₤ 75 - ₤ 200+Rekeying Locks₤ 50 - ₤ 150Detailed Breakdown of Services
Lockout Assistance
This is the most common factor individuals call a locksmith. It usually costs in between 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, depending on the time and area.
Key Duplication
Easy keys can be duplicated for ₤ 10 to ₤ 30. However, state-of-the-art secrets, such as transponder or smart keys, can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 200.
Ignition Repair/Replacement
If you're facing ignition problems, repair may cost in between ₤ 100 to ₤ 250, while complete replacement might be on the greater end.
Transponder Key Programming
This service is necessary when you have a lost secret that requires shows. Costs can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 300.
Secret Extraction
If a key breaks in the lock or ignition, extraction services vary from ₤ 60 to ₤ 200.
Emergency Services
Calling a locksmith after hours can cost considerably more, frequently starting at ₤ 75 and potentially exceeding ₤ 200.
Rekeying Locks
If you wish to change the locks on your lorry without complete replacement, rekeying can c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150.Extra Costs to Consider
When budgeting for locksmith services, it's essential to be knowledgeable about possible additional costs:
Travel Fees: Some locksmith professionals might charge a travel fee if they need to cover a considerable distance.Service Call Fees: A preliminary service call cost might be examined, especially if you require emergency services.Parts and Materials: If brand-new parts are required (like locks or ignition parts), those expenses will be included to the total service cost.Tips to Save on Car Locksmith ServicesResearch Local Locksmiths: Get quotes from several locksmith professionals to find a competitive rate.Ask About Upfront Pricing: Ensure you comprehend all possible charges before the locksmith begins work.Think About Membership Discounts: Some auto clubs use discounts on locksmith services to their members.Use Insurance: Check if your Car Locksmith Prices insurance covers locksmith services; you may be able to file a claim.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How long does it consider a car locksmith to arrive?

A: Most car locksmith professionals intend to show up within 15 to 30 minutes, but this can vary based upon area, time of day, and traffic conditions.

Q2: Will my insurance cover locksmith services?

A: Many insurance policies have coverage for locksmith services, particularly if you are locked out due to a theft or an emergency. Examine your policy or call your insurance agent for information.

Q3: Is it better to call a car dealership for key replacement?

A: While dealerships typically have the proficiency and can configure secrets, they might charge significantly more than independent locksmiths. It's worth comparing rates and services.

Q4: Can I prevent getting locked out of my car once again?

A: Yes! Consider purchasing an extra secret and keeping it in a safe place. You can likewise use an essential finder app or a physical keychain tracker to help keep tabs on your keys.

Q5: Are all locksmiths geared up for modern-day vehicles?

A: Not all locksmith professionals have the tools and training to handle newer vehicles, especially those with sophisticated locking systems. It's smart to confirm their know-how ahead of time.
